POSITION SUMMARY :

The primary purpose of your job is to administer medications to residents as ordered by the attending Physician, under the direction of a licensed nurse within the scope of practice for Medication Aides.

The administration of medication shall be in accordance with established nursing standards, the community policies, procedures, and practices, and the requirements of the state in which you operate.

Education & Qualifications :

  • Be listed in good standing on the registry as a medication aide in the state in which you work.
  • Passed the QMA competency evaluation program consisting of a written test, if your state requires.
  • Must be currently enrolled in a high school program or have a high school diploma or equivalent.
  • Must be able to communicate in English and have the ability to follow verbal and written instructions.
  • Must possess and demonstrate the ability to carry out both verbal and written directions.
  • Must possess and demonstrate good interpersonal skills and attention to detail.
  • Ability to work with supervisors, co-workers and community staff in the performance of duties.
  • Ability to observe proper safety and sanitary techniques.
  • Ability to work hours as scheduled based on the requirements of the position / assignment.
  • Must not pose a direct threat to the health and safety of others in the workplace.

Experience :

Previous experience in long-term care preferred, but not required.
